Who was Heinrich XXIV, Count Reuss of Ebersdorf?
Heinrich XXIV, Count Reuss of Ebersdorf, was ruler of the German county Reuss-Ebersdorf from 1747 till his death.
He was the eldest son of the thirteen children of Heinrich XXIX, Count of Reuss-Ebersdorf and Sophie Theodora of Castell-Remlingen. He was the grandfather of King Leopold I of Belgium and the great-grandfather of Queen Victoria.
Heinrich XXIV succeeded his father as Count of Reuss-Ebersdorf in 1747.
